    SUMMER is fast approaching and parents are on the lookout for things to keep their youngsters productively occupied during August.

    There is no need to look too far afield with South Ockendon-based Grangewaters hosting its Summer Spectacular.

    The Great Grangewaters Summer Spectacular provides summer holiday activities for boys and girls aged between ten and 14

    The first week – 3 to 7 August – is Wet Week with sailing, kayaking, open canoeing, raft building, funboards, and open water swimming where those who take past can learn new skills, be challenged, and enjoy competitions and fun.

    The 30 hours of activity – plus warm-up and cool down sessions – run daily throughout the week; arrival at between 8am and 8.30am, and finishing between 5.30pm and 6pm.

    The cost is £140 per person for the week.

    Week two – 10 to 14 August – is Boot Camp, a non-residential week of physical challenges to get people fit and help them stay fit. There will be hard and challenging activities all week, geared to the individual so that by the end of the week they will feel a great sense of achievement.

    Again, there are 30 hours of activity plus warm-up and cool down sessions daily with the arrival and departure times, and the cost, the same as the week before.

    Dry Week is the title of the third week, from 17 to 21 August with climbing, abseiling, high ropes, zip line, mountain biking, orienteering and archery sessions.

    Again, people can learn new skills, challenges, enjoy competitions and have fun during 30 hours of activity plus warm-up and cool down sessions between 8am (to 8.30am) and 5.30pm (to 6pm) each day for a total of £140 per person.

    Finally, during 23 to 27 August, the centre is hosting the Great Grangewaters Summer Camp where visitors will be able to stay the week in the bunkhouses with all meals provided, a multi-activity daytime programme, at least six hours a day, and evening entertainments and campfires – fun and adventure from start to finish.

    Arrival for this is expected between 8am and 8.30am on Monday, 23 August, with departure planned for between 5.30pm and 6pm on Friday, 27 August at a cost of £275 per person fully inclusive.
